Why would I Need Alcohol Detox in Jacksonville?


When heavy or frequent drinkers suddenly decide to quit "cold turkey" they will experience some physical withdrawal symptoms -- which can range from the mildly annoying to severe and even life-threatening. For this reason, an alcohol detox in Jacksonville is often necessary.

An alcohol detox center in Jacksonville would be the first step of recovery from alcohol abuse. Alcohol detox centers in Jacksonville are designed to safely manage physical withdrawal symptoms while coming of alcohol as well as assist with psychological and emotional discomforts of coming off alcohol. Alcohol detox should be done under the care of a licensed medical facility in Jacksonville. Attempting to detox from alcohol without proper professional help is extremely dangerous. It can result in serious physical, psychological, and emotional consequences which can include death.

It is important to note that Jacksonville alcohol detox is only the initial step in the alcohol abuse recovery process. Alcohol detox programs only provide physical and emotional stabilization while going through alcohol withdrawal and therefore, alcohol detox in Jacksonville should not be viewed as full rehabilitation. Jacksonville Alcoholism Treatment Programs will append efforts to maintain the gains made in alcohol detox, while working towards establishing a firm ground upon which future long-term recovery is to be built.

Research has shown that the vast majority of people in Jacksonville that complete alcohol detox, but fail to continue treatment in a Jacksonville residential Alcoholism Treatment Program and Alcohol Detox Center, end up in relapse. Alcohol detox is a vital component in the recovery process, but lasting recovery in Jacksonville is generally achieved through a structured Alcoholism Treatment Program that addresses the root of the addiction and not just its physical effects.




What should I expect during alcohol rehab in Jacksonville?


Attending an Alcoholism Treatment Program and Alcohol Detox Center in Jacksonville can be different for each person, however, there are some similarities that can be expected. The first step of a Jacksonville Alcoholism Treatment Program is often alcohol detoxification (withdrawal). Alcohol withdrawal is when a person with an alcohol abuse problem stops drinking alcohol. Alcohol withdrawal can last a few days and may include nausea or vomiting, sweating, shakiness, and anxiety. These symptoms will be reduced effectively by attending an Alcohol Rehabilitation Program in Jacksonville. Some Alcoholism Treatment Programs in Jacksonville will offer an on-site alcohol detox while others may have you attend an off-site medical detox center and then have you return to complete the Jacksonville Alcohol Rehab Program and Alcohol Detoxification Facility once the detoxification process is complete. Either way, the person in recovery must withdrawal from the alcohol which is safer and more comfortable when done as part of a Jacksonville Alcohol Treatment Center.

For some, the initial alcohol detox process is the hardest part of attending an Alcoholism Treatment Program and Alcohol Detoxification Center in Jacksonville. Others find that their difficulty arises in therapy where they must confront their misguided beliefs and addictive behaviors. Often times, the recovering alcohol abuser will tend to unknowingly focus on present time problems going on with family, friends, loved ones, and issues at home. This is usually an attempt to avoid confronting their own problems by focusing on outside distractions. It is important for family and loved ones to avoid involving the addict with issues at home or anything other than their treatment plan. The addict must keep focused on himself and confront his own issues and his case points that need addressed.

What is the Primary Focus of an Alcohol Rehab in Jacksonville?


The primary focus of an Alcoholism Treatment Program and Alcohol Detox Center in Jacksonville is not only to help the individual to stop drinking alcohol, but also to restore the person to productive functioning within their family, relationships, workplace and community. While attending an effective Alcoholism Treatment Program in Jacksonville the individual will learn life skills, coping skills, and work through underlying issues, trauma's and transgressions. They will be better able to cope with daily life and manage their thoughts, feelings and emotions.

The first focus of most Alcoholism Treatment Programs in Jacksonville is often alcohol detox where the individual is restored physically back to health. Various methods may be used to monitor, manage, and minimize alcohol withdrawal symptoms. Focus is then put on diet, nutrition, exercise and sleep until the individual is eating healthy meals regularly, sleeping regularly, has increased energy and feels healthy physically.

The next focus of an effective Alcohol Rehabilitation Program in Jacksonville involves working to improve self-esteem and self-worth, heal core traumas, learn life-skills, gain control over addictive patterns and improve psychological health in addition to recovering from alcohol abuse. Counseling focuses on the symptoms of alcohol abuse, the individual and the structure of the individual's recovery program. It teaches coping strategies and tools for recovery.

The final focus of an effective Alcohol Rehab Program and Alcohol Detoxification Facility in Jacksonville is to also to offer the individual the necessary tools to continue to remain alcohol-free once they have completed the rehab program and have re-entered into society. Clients will learn about addiction, recovery, relapse, and how to address misguided beliefs about self, others, and their environment. In addition, they learn to identify relapse warning signs and methods to challenge thoughts that may lead to relapse.
